Top Colleges for Business in Pennsylvania
After conducting extensive research, analyzing survey results, and studying data, here are the top colleges for business in Pennsylvania:
- Wharton School of the University of Pennsylvania
- Carnegie Mellon University – Tepper School of Business
- Lehigh University – College of Business and Economics
- Villanova University – School of Business
- Temple University – Fox School of Business

Interesting Facts About Business Education in Pennsylvania
- The Wharton School of the University of Pennsylvania is consistently ranked as the top business school in the country.
- Carnegie Mellon University’s Tepper School of Business has produced several Nobel laureates in economics.
- Villanova University’s School of Business was ranked #1 in the country for online graduate business programs by U.S. News & World Report in 2023.

What kind of job opportunities are available to business graduates in Pennsylvania?
Pennsylvania is home to many Fortune 500 companies, including Comcast, Hershey, and PNC Financial Services. Business graduates can find job opportunities in industries such as finance, marketing, and management.
